Abstract

An oxidation reaction catalyzed by ruthenium ions has revealed that high-molecular asphaltenes of methano-naphthene oil from the Krapivinskoye oilfield contains structural fragments linked by means of Car-C bridges and non-covalently bound (occluded) compounds. It was found that covalently bound fragments in the composition of high mo-lecular weight asphaltenes of Krapivinskaya oil are represented by alkanes of normal structure, aromatic structures of biphenyl type and naphthalenes located in the periphery of the molecule. Typical hydrocarbon biomarkers such as n-alkanes, steranes, and terpanes are present among the occluded compounds.
